    Scott Newton Schools is an American lawyer and the chief compliance officer of OpenAI. [1] Schools previously served as the chief ethics and compliance officer of Uber. [ 2 ] Before joining Uber, Schools was the highest-ranking career civil servant at the United States Department of Justice , serving as associate deputy attorney general .

    Additionally, the attorney general advises the president of the United States on appointments to federal judicial positions and Department of Justice roles, including U.S. Attorneys and U.S. Marshals. While the attorney general may represent the United States in the Supreme Court and other courts, this is typically handled by the solicitor general.

    Jonathan Seth Kanter [1] (born July 30, 1973) is an American lawyer who served as Assistant Attorney General for the Antitrust Division of the U.S. Department of Justice (DOJ) from 2021 to 2024, during the administration of President Joe Biden.

    Claire McCusker Murray (2019) Claire McCusker Murray (born April 19, 1982) [citation needed] is an American lawyer who served as associate White House counsel and acting associate attorney general in the United States Department of Justice during the first presidency of Donald Trump.
